  • Putnam, Laugeni Sweep CCC Women’s Basketball Weekly Awards
    March 02, 2020
    BEVERLY, Mass. – Endicott women’s basketball student-athletes Kaleigh Putnam (Wallingford, Conn.) and Tara Laugeni (Woodbridge, Conn.) have received weekly awards from the Commonwealth Coast Conference (CCC), as announced by the league earlier today. Putnam was named the CCC Player of the Week, while Laugeni garnered CCC Rookie of the Week honors. Both awards are firsts in their respective careers.
  • CCC CHAMPIONSHIP: No. 3 Endicott Downs No. 4 UNE For First-Ever Conference Title, 74-57
    February 29, 2020
    BEVERLY, Mass. – The third-seeded Endicott women’s basketball team defeated fourth-seeded University of New England (UNE), 74-57, in the Commonwealth Coast Conference (CCC) Championship on Saturday evening to capture its first-ever conference title in program history.
